テゾス(XTZ)の独自機能「自己改良機能」とは?



テゾス(XTZ)の独自機能「自己改良機能」とは?


テゾス(XTZ)の独自機能「自己改良機能」とは?

テゾス(Tezos、XTZ)は、自己修正可能なブロックチェーンとして知られる、革新的な暗号資産プラットフォームです。その中核をなすのが「自己改良機能」であり、これはテゾスの他のブロックチェーンとの重要な差別化要因となっています。本稿では、テゾスの自己改良機能について、そのメカニズム、利点、そして将来的な展望を詳細に解説します。

1. ブロックチェーンの進化とテゾスの誕生

ブロックチェーン技術は、その分散性と不変性により、金融、サプライチェーン管理、投票システムなど、様々な分野での応用が期待されています。しかし、初期のブロックチェーンには、その設計上の制約から、機能拡張やバグ修正が困難であるという課題がありました。例えば、ビットコインは、そのプロトコルを変更することが非常に難しく、結果として、新しい技術を取り入れるのが遅れていました。このような状況を打破するために、テゾスは、ブロックチェーンの自己改良機能を組み込むことで、より柔軟で持続可能なプラットフォームを目指しました。

2. 自己改良機能のメカニズム

テゾスの自己改良機能は、オンチェーンガバナンスと形式的検証という二つの主要な要素によって構成されています。

2.1 オンチェーンガバナンス

テゾスのガバナンスシステムは、トークン保有者がプロトコルの変更提案に投票できるオンチェーンガバナンスを採用しています。具体的には、以下のプロセスを経てプロトコルが変更されます。

  1. 提案(Proposal): テゾスの開発者やコミュニティメンバーは、プロトコルの変更提案を作成し、ネットワークに公開します。
  2. 投票期間(Voting Period): トークン保有者は、提案された変更内容を評価し、賛成または反対の投票を行います。投票には、トークンを「ベイキング(Baking)」と呼ばれるプロセスを通じてステークする必要があります。
  3. クォーラム(Quorum): 提案が承認されるためには、一定割合以上のトークン保有者が投票に参加する必要があります。
  4. 承認(Adoption): クォーラムを満たし、かつ、賛成票が一定の閾値を超えた場合、提案は承認され、プロトコルが更新されます。

このオンチェーンガバナンスシステムにより、テゾスは、中央集権的な権力に依存することなく、コミュニティの合意に基づいてプロトコルを進化させることができます。

2.2 形式的検証(Formal Verification)

テゾスは、プロトコルの変更を実装する際に、形式的検証という技術を採用しています。形式的検証とは、数学的な手法を用いて、ソフトウェアの仕様が正しく実装されていることを厳密に証明する技術です。これにより、プロトコルの変更によって予期せぬバグや脆弱性が生じるリスクを大幅に低減することができます。テゾスは、Michelsonという専用のスマートコントラクト言語を使用しており、このMichelsonは、形式的検証に適した設計となっています。

3. 自己改良機能の利点

テゾスの自己改良機能は、以下の点で大きな利点をもたらします。

3.1 柔軟性と適応性

テゾスは、自己改良機能により、市場の変化や技術の進歩に迅速に対応することができます。新しい機能の追加やバグ修正を、コミュニティの合意に基づいてスムーズに行うことができるため、常に最新の状態を維持することができます。

3.2 セキュリティの向上

形式的検証の採用により、プロトコルの変更に伴うセキュリティリスクを最小限に抑えることができます。これにより、テゾスは、より安全で信頼性の高いプラットフォームとして、ユーザーからの信頼を得ることができます。

3.3 コミュニティ主導の開発

オンチェーンガバナンスシステムにより、テゾスの開発は、コミュニティ主導で行われます。トークン保有者は、プロトコルの変更に直接関与し、その方向性を決定することができます。これにより、テゾスは、より民主的で透明性の高いプラットフォームとして、コミュニティの活性化に貢献することができます。

3.4 ハードフォークの回避

従来のブロックチェーンでは、プロトコルの変更を行う際に、ハードフォークと呼ばれるプロセスが必要となることがありました。ハードフォークは、ブロックチェーンを二つに分岐させる可能性があり、コミュニティの分裂や混乱を引き起こすことがあります。テゾスの自己改良機能は、ハードフォークを回避し、スムーズなプロトコルアップグレードを実現することができます。

4. 自己改良機能の実践例

テゾスは、これまでにも自己改良機能を活用して、いくつかの重要なプロトコルアップグレードを実施してきました。例えば、以下のアップグレードが挙げられます。

  • Florence: スマートコントラクトの実行効率を向上させ、ガス消費量を削減しました。
  • Granada: スナップショットの最適化を行い、ガバナンスプロセスの効率化を図りました。
  • Hanoi: ネットワークのセキュリティを強化し、スケーラビリティを向上させました。

これらのアップグレードは、いずれもコミュニティの合意に基づいて実施され、テゾスのプラットフォームをより強力で使いやすいものにしています。

5. 自己改良機能の課題と将来展望

テゾスの自己改良機能は、多くの利点をもたらす一方で、いくつかの課題も抱えています。例えば、ガバナンスプロセスが複雑であるため、トークン保有者の投票参加率が低い場合があります。また、形式的検証には、高度な専門知識が必要であり、そのコストも高くなる可能性があります。しかし、テゾスの開発チームは、これらの課題を克服するために、様々な取り組みを行っています。例えば、ガバナンスインターフェースの改善や、形式的検証ツールの開発などが挙げられます。

将来的には、テゾスの自己改良機能は、さらに進化し、より柔軟で効率的なプラットフォームを実現することが期待されます。例えば、より高度なガバナンスメカニズムの導入や、AIを活用した形式的検証の自動化などが考えられます。また、テゾスは、他のブロックチェーンとの相互運用性を高めることで、より広範なエコシステムを構築することを目指しています。

6. まとめ

テゾスの自己改良機能は、ブロックチェーン技術の進化における重要な一歩です。オンチェーンガバナンスと形式的検証という二つの要素を組み合わせることで、テゾスは、柔軟性、セキュリティ、そしてコミュニティ主導の開発を実現しています。自己改良機能は、テゾスを、他のブロックチェーンとは一線を画す、革新的なプラットフォームとして位置づけています。今後、テゾスの自己改良機能がどのように進化し、ブロックチェーン業界にどのような影響を与えるのか、注目していく必要があります。


前の記事

カルダノ(ADA)ステーキング報酬の計算方法を紹介!

次の記事

カルダノ(ADA)とイーサリアム:開発者視点での比較

コメントを書く

Leave a Comment

メールアドレスが公開されることはありません。 が付いている欄は必須項目です